Job Summary

Iron Mountain is seeking a strategic and high-agency Competitive Strategist to join our Digital Business Unit (DBU). In this role, you will be responsible for monitoring, analyzing, and positioning against a defined set of competitors to shape the narrative for our priority products and services.

What You’ll Do

In this role, you will:

  • Develop and communicate actionable competitive strategies by filtering raw data from the Center of Excellence (COE) into "McKinsey-style" executive reports and "Why We Win" sales narratives.
     

  • Collaborate with Product, Marketing, and Sales leadership to pressure-test findings, provide independent points of view on market movements, and triage high-value deals for tactical seller support.
     

  • Manage proprietary intelligence frameworks and communication channels, including updating the competitor threat scoring framework quarterly and curating the internal Competitor Watch chat and newsletter.
     

What You’ll Bring

The ideal candidate will have:

  • 5–8 years of experience in Competitive Intelligence, Management Consulting, or Product Marketing within the Business-to-Business (B2B) Software as a Service (SaaS) or enterprise software industry.
     

  • Strong knowledge of analytical frameworks and data tools, including the ability to conduct "bottom-up" financial analyses and leverage Artificial Intelligence (AI) tools for research.
     

  • Proven ability in executive-level storytelling and slide design, with a focus on visual hierarchy, detail-oriented formatting, and bilingual proficiency in English.
     

  • A Bachelor’s degree is required, while a Master of Business Administration (MBA) would be a Nice to Have.
